Inspect for Access Points
To start rodent-proofing your attic, inspect for entrance points. Start by thoroughly checking out the outside of your home, searching for any openings that rodents could use to get to your attic. Look for spaces around utility lines, vents, and pipes, as well as any type of cracks or openings in the foundation or house siding. Make sure to pay very close attention to areas where various structure products satisfy, as these prevail entrance factors for rodents.
Additionally, examine the roof covering for any kind of harmed or missing roof shingles, along with any voids around the edges where rodents could press through. Inside the attic room, seek indications of existing rodent activity such as droppings, ate cords, or nesting products. Utilize a flashlight to completely check dark edges and covert areas.
Seal Cracks and Gaps
Evaluate your attic room completely for any type of fractures and voids that need to be secured to stop rats from entering. Rodents can press through also the tiniest openings, so it's essential to seal any type of prospective access points. Check around pipelines, vents, wires, and where the walls meet the roof. Make use of a mix of steel wool and caulking to seal these openings successfully. Steel woollen is an exceptional deterrent as rats can't eat via it. Make certain that all voids are firmly sealed to deny accessibility to unwanted insects.
Do not forget the importance of securing spaces around windows and doors too. Usage weather removing or door sweeps to secure these locations successfully. Examine the areas where utility lines enter the attic room and seal them off making use of an ideal sealer. By putting in the time to seal all splits and gaps in your attic, you create an obstacle that rats will certainly locate challenging to violation. Avoidance is type in rodent-proofing your attic, so be thorough in your efforts to seal any possible entrance points.
Get Rid Of Food Sources
Take aggressive measures to get rid of or keep all potential food resources in your attic room to discourage rodents from infesting the space. Rats are brought in to food, so eliminating their food sources is vital in keeping them out of your attic.
Here's what you can do:
1. ** Store food securely **: Prevent leaving any food products in the attic. Shop all food in closed containers made of steel or sturdy plastic to avoid rodents from accessing them.
2. ** Clean up debris **: Eliminate any piles of debris, such as old papers, cardboard boxes, or wood scraps, that rodents could utilize as nesting material or food resources. Maintain the attic clutter-free to make it less appealing to rats.
3. ** Dispose of rubbish properly **: If you use your attic for storage space and have waste or waste up there, make sure to throw away it consistently and effectively. Rotting garbage can bring in rats, so maintain the attic room tidy and devoid of any organic waste.
